潜力值

来自Arcaea中文维基
Indcat讨论 | 贡献2020年9月18日 (五) 06:27的版本

Potential组成

Potential(可简称“ptt”)由40个成绩取均值而成,其中30个best成绩(简称“best30”或“b30”)和30个recent成绩(简称“recent30”或“r30”)中的10个top成绩(简称“recent top10”或“r10”)。

  • best30是所有谱面中最高的30个成绩,中间没有相同的谱面出现(可以是同一首歌的不同难度),该部分的值只升不降,也就是说只要正常游玩一首曲目[1]后你的ptt就不可能再次归零[2]
  • recent30是较近30次的曲目游玩成绩,按照时间顺序排列,其中取10次不同谱面的最高的成绩作为top
    • 上传一次成绩后,更迭分两种情况:
      • 分数小于EX直接写入末尾,recent最早的pc写出,也就是按时间顺序写入与写出recent
      • 分数大于等于EX或者困难模式Track Lost,如果比top中的最小值大(也就是可以更新top),那么会把recent中ptt最低的pc写出(同ptt则取最早);否则不计入。
    • 虽然v3.0.0以后Recent的成绩计算时去除了相同谱面成绩的影响,但是在一定次数游玩后依然会写出最早的Recent记录,即使你在此期间仅仅游玩过已经写入Recent的谱面
    • v3.0.0之后任何Recent成绩不论分数,在写入时都会保证Recent30内仍有至少10个不同谱面的成绩(如果之前的谱面种类不足10种,则保持种类数不降低)。
    • 这里的困难模式Track Lost就是指Hard回忆条降至0导致的Track lost,与EX效果相同
  • 对于违反规则的特例:需明确一点就是ptt通过联网计算再获取返回值,在多设备登陆的情况下会出现多次上传成绩,所以变化不可估

单次成绩ptt计算

分数 单次成绩ptt
≥ 10,000,000(即PM) 定数+2 (此时屏蔽物量影响)
≥ 9,800,000 且 < 10,000,000 定数+1+(分数 - 9,800,000)/200,000
< 9,800,000 定数+(分数 - 9,500,000)/300,000 (下限为0)

所以说,单次成绩ptt为0的通式为

分数 ≤ 9,500,000 - 定数 × 300,000


总的来说,单次成绩ptt与评级和分数的关系见下

评级 分数 单次成绩ptt
EX+ 10,001,450 定数+2.00
10,000,000 定数+2.00
9,950,000 定数+1.75
9,900,000 定数+1.50
EX 9,800,000 定数+1.00
AA 9,500,000 定数
A 9,200,000 定数-1.00
B 8,900,000 定数-2.00
C 8,600,000 定数-3.00

单次成绩ptt下限为0

谱面定数

所有谱面定数

感谢重测算成员 RichadoWonosas(理论与机制证明)、Blurring Shadow(机制验证与协助测算)、Xecus(技术支持)以及其他全体同时协助测算的玩家们orz

涉及到JPwiki的数据

JPwiki原页面

Songs FTR Level PRS Level PST Level BYD Level
Grievous Lady 11.3 9.3 6.5
Fracture Ray 11.2 9.5 6.0
SAIKYO STRONGER 11.0 9.4 5.5
#1f1e33 10.9 9.2 5.5
BUCHiGiRE Berserker 10.9 8.6 5.0
Axium Crisis 10.9 8.5 5.5
World Vanquisher 10.9 5.5 2.5
Cyaegha 10.8 8.4 5.5
Ringed Genesis 10.8 8.4 5.5
Dantalion 10.8 8.2 5.0
Halcyon 10.7 8.2 5.5
ouroboros -twin stroke of the end- 10.7 7.0 4.5
Singularity 10.7 7.5 4.5
Corps-sans-organes 10.6 7.5 4.5
Tempestissimo 10.6 9.5 6.5 11.5
cyanine 10.6 7.5 4.0
Tiferet 10.6 7.5 4.5
GLORY:ROAD 10.6 7.0 4.5
γuarδina 10.5 7.5 4.0
Ikazuchi 10.5 7.5 3.5
Garakuta Doll Play 10.4 6.5 4.5
Valhalla:0 10.4 7.0 4.5
Ether Strike 10.3 8.3 5.5
Nirv lucE 10.3 7.0 2.5
Metallic Punisher 10.2 7.0 3.0
Sheriruth 10.2 7.5 5.5
IZANA 10.2 8.3 5.0
αterlβus 10.2 7.0 4.0
Scarlet Lance 10.1 7.0 4.0
conflict 10.1 7.5 4.5
PRAGMATISM 10.1 8.6 4.5
trappola bewitching 10.0 6.0 3.0
Modelista 10.0 7.5 3.5
Vicious Heroism 10.0 7.5 4.0
Alexandrite 10.0 7.0 4.5
Mirzam 10.0 7.0 4.0
Heavensdoor 9.9 7.5 4.5
Nhelv 9.9 6.5 3.0
SOUNDWiTCH 9.9 6.5 3.5
Corruption 9.9 6.5 3.0
Arcahv 9.9 7.5 4.5
Antagonism 9.9 7.5 4.5
Heavenly caress 9.8 7.5 3.5
Lost Desire 9.8 7.5 4.0
DX Choseinou Full Metal Shojo 9.8 6.0 3.0
Got hive of Ra 9.8 6.5 3.0
Memory Forest 9.8 6.0 3.5
Einherjar Joker 9.8 7.0 4.0
SUPERNOVA 9.8 6.0 3.0
Linear Accelerator 9.8 6.5 2.5
Dreadnought 9.8 7.0 4.0
Scarlet Cage 9.7 7.0 4.0
Altale 9.7 5.5 2.5
Filament 9.7 7.5 4.5
BATTLE NO.1 9.7 6.5 3.5
Black Lotus 9.7 6.5 3.0
Lethaeus 9.7 6.5 3.5
BLRINK 9.7 7.5 3.5
A Wandering Melody of Love 9.7 7.5 3.5
Black Territory 9.7 7.5 3.0
The Message 9.7 6.5 3.0
Sulfur 9.7 6.0 4.0
Quon 9.7 6.5 4.0
BADTEK 9.7 7.0 4.0
LunarOrbit -believe in the Espebranch road- 9.6 6.0 3.5
Monochrome Princess 9.6 7.5 4.5
Illegal Paradise 9.6 7.0 2.0
Avant Raze 9.6 6.5 3.5
Dreamin' Attraction!! 9.6 7.0 4.5
Fallensquare 9.6 7.0 3.0
Astral tale 9.6 7.0 4.5
carmine:scythe 9.6 7.5 4.0
amygdata 9.6 7.5 4.0
Vindication 9.6 6.5 4.0
STAGER (ALL STAGE CLEAR) 9.5 6.5 3.0
OMAKENO Stroke 9.5 6.5 3.0
Specta 9.5 6.5 3.5
Party Vinyl 9.5 7.5 4.0
Cybernecia Catharsis 9.5 7.0 4.0
AI[UE]OON 9.5 6.5 3.5
DataErr0r 9.5 7.0 3.0
MAHOROBA 9.5 6.5 3.0
Be There 9.4 7.5 4.0
Red and Blue 9.4 7.5 4.0
Your voice so... feat. Such 9.4 6.5 3.5
CROSS✝︎SOUL 9.4 7.0 4.0
Yosakura Fubuki 9.4 7.0 4.5
Impure Bird 9.4 5.5 2.0
VECTOЯ 9.4 7.0 3.0
Equilibrium 9.4 6.5 3.5
Teriqma 9.4 6.5 3.0
Feels So Right feat. Renko 9.3 6.5 3.5
Auxesia 9.3 6.5 3.5
Syro 9.3 6.5 3.5
Blaster 9.3 7.0 4.0
Oracle 9.3 5.5 3.0
GOODTEK(Arcaea Edit) 9.3 6.5 4.0 9.8
Ignotus 9.3 6.5 3.5
Anökumene 9.2 6.5 2.5
Rugie 9.2 6.0 3.0
Phantasia 9.2 5.5 4.0
Lost Civilization 9.2 7.0 4.0
Libertas 9.2 5.5 3.5
Strongholds 9.2 5.0 2.5
Faint Light (Arcaea Edit) 9.1 6.0 3.0
Chronostasis 9.1 7.5 3.5
dropdead 9.1 9.5 1.5
Iconoclast 9.1 7.0 4.0
La'qryma of the Wasteland 9.1 6.5 3.5
qualia -ideaesthesia- 9.1 7.0 4.5
Essence of Twilight 9.1 7.0 4.5
Kanagawa Cyber Culvert 9.0 5.5 1.0
Flyburg and Endroll 9.0 6.0 3.0
Give Me a Nightmare 9.0 5.5 3.5
Empire of Winter 9.0 6.5 3.5
ReviXy 9.0 6.0 3.0
Maze No.9 8.9 3.5 3.0
Evoltex (poppi'n mix) 8.9 7.0 2.0
MERLIN 8.9 5.5 3.0
memoryfactory.lzh 8.9 5.5 2.5
Surrender 8.8 6.5 3.0
Flashback 8.8 5.0 2.0
Antithese 8.8 5.0 2.0
Particle Arts 8.8 6.0 3.5
Solitary Dream 8.8 7.0 4.0
next to you 8.8 7.0 4.5
Vivid Theory 8.8 5.0 2.0
Senkyou 8.7 5.5 3.0
Call My Name feat. Yukacco 8.7 6.0 3.5
FREEF4LL 8.6 7.0 4.0
Grimheart 8.6 5.0 2.5
Silent Rush 8.6 5.0 2.5
Journey 8.6 6.0 3.0
Gekka (Short Version) 8.6 6.0 4.0
cry of viyella 8.5 6.0 3.5
Babaroque 8.5 6.5 3.0
Harutopia ~Utopia of Spring~ 8.5 4.5 1.0
Reinvent 8.5 6.5 2.5
world.execute(me); 8.5 5.5 3.5
Dandelion 8.5 6.0 2.5
Chelsea 8.5 6.0 3.0
Rabbit In The Black Room 8.4 5.5 2.5
Moonheart 8.4 5.5 2.5
Purgatorium 8.4 6.0 2.5 9.6
Lumia 8.4 5.5 2.5
Snow White 8.4 5.0 2.5
REconstruction 8.4 6.0 2.5
Oblivia 8.3 5.0 3.5
Dot to Dot feat. shully 8.3 6.0 3.0
Tie me down gently 8.3 5.5 3.0
Shades of Light in a Transcendent Realm 8.3 6.0 3.0
Bookmaker (2D Version) 8.3 6.5 4.5
Genesis 8.2 5.5 2.0
One Last Drive 8.2 5.5 2.5
Hall of Mirrors 8.2 5.5 3.0
Lucifer 8.2 5.5 3.5
1F√ 8.2 6.5 2.5
Hikari 8.1 6.0 2.5
I've heard it said 8.1 6.0 3.5
Diode 8.1 5.5 2.5
Relentless 8.0 6.5 4.5
Dement ~after legend~ 7.5 6.0 3.5 9.9
Brand new world 7.5 4.0 2.0
Paradise 7.5 4.0 1.0
inkar-usi 7.5 4.0 2.0
Moonlight of Sand Castle 7.5 5.0 1.5
Suomi 7.5 5.0 2.0
Rise 7.5 4.0 2.5
Infinity Heaven 7.5 5.5 1.5 9.6
Dream goes on 7.5 5.0 1.5
Clotho and the stargazer 7.5 5.0 2.0
Romance Wars 7.5 4.0 1.0
Blossoms 7.0 4.0 1.0
Vexaria 7.0 5.0 2.5 8.8
Fairytale 7.0 3.5 1.0 9.5
Sayonara Hatsukoi 7.0 4.5 1.5
  • 结合数据可以计算出,截至目前版本(V3.2.0)理论上能达到的最高ptt值为12.74
    • 而在不充值(即仅使用ArcaeaWorld Extend曲包(假设所有曲目全部获得)的数据计算)的情况下,这个值是11.45

测定方法

历史回溯法(choka法)
由于3.0版本的recent成绩不再包含相同曲目,因此这个测定方法已经失效。

原理:30best+10recent,AA时单曲成绩ptt等于定数

  1. 首先,建一个新账户
  2. 打三遍同一个谱面,尽量控分在950w,此时当前ptt应当为
  3. ptt=(recent成绩总和+best成绩总和)/40
  4. 根据ptt的构成推导得 ptt=(定数x3 + 定数x1)/40 =定数/10 即得到定数=当前ptt*10
  • 优点:只要打少量的次数即可,无大量时间金钱投入。
  • 缺点:每次都要新建账户,浪费服务器资源;精度有限;对普通玩家而言本方法只能用于估测(并且要打至少4遍),需要控分,难度过高。
STEP法(robert法)
原理:World模式的STEP值与单次成绩ptt成绩有关

如果在World结算时,初始的STEP值大于2.5

定数=(9,500,000 - (分数 - ((初始STEP值-2.5) / 0.004473062)^2)) / 300,000
或者
STEP值= 2.5 +2.45√游玩定数


初始STEP值误差很大,可以通过人物来扩大STEP值。

STEP最小值= max(加成后STEP值 / (人物STEP数值/50), 初始STEP值)

STEP最大值= min((加成后STEP值+0.1) / (人物STEP数值/50), 初始STEP值 + 0.1)


需要指出的是,这个算法并未考虑STEP数值也是浮点数,也有误差


1.7.0更新后,采取play+加成可以进一步缩小误差

STEP最小值= max(加成后STEP值 / ((人物STEP数值/50)×play+加成), 初始STEP值)

STEP最大值= min((加成后STEP值+0.1) / ((人物STEP数值/50)×play+加成), 初始STEP值 + 0.1)


优点:一次算出,无需新注册号,无需控分

缺点:受World体力限制,定数越低要求分数越高,需要大量时间金钱投入,精度不够(最高±0.2)

研究过程与验证

  • 3.0版本之前的EX保护机制
在现有ptt计算准则条件下,有关recent的记录常常有一定出入,在某一单曲得分对应ptt低于现有总ptt平均分时,有些情况显示keep而有些情况会产生扣分,由此推测对于recent的记录是有选择性的。
根据robert_cpp的计算表附加说明,“持续得到EX评价时无关曲目的其余任何条件,ptt会始终保持keep结算。”
有理由认为recent的记录出入与是否得到EX评级有关。
Vanitas的掉分实证推论过程
先放置清空recent(结算根据是:当前ptt=30个best总成绩之和/40,说明recent总和为0。)

24次FTR EX(无PM)外加高定数曲目5次AA和1次标记项目,且计入ptt计算的10次recent得分(含AA项)偏差值在±0.4以内, 再持续获得30次PST/PRS的EX+FR时,ptt始终保持keep,下一步即第31次完成标记项目(SOUNDWiTCH FTR半放置等效得分8.4,小于上一步最后成绩得分Sheriruth PRS(9.7)) 同时成绩严格小于前30pc任意一次; 此操作过后立即开始30次放置掉分,结果显示在前20次放置中ptt整体减分有0.05,主要减分阶段在最后10次;

结果以及分析结论 标记项目得分8.4的成绩在最后被去除(-0.21), 9.8 说明10项最高recent记录并不会被最后整理至写出队列尾部,而是依旧保持日期顺序。(否则前20次不会掉分)

最后10次任一减分对应单曲成绩(-0.27±0.01)均大于上一步所达成的全部次难度成绩 由此可知PST/PRS EX的任何记录没有写入到recent。

推论是:对于任何EX评级的成绩,如果将其写入recent队列会导致ptt下降,则该成绩并不会写入队列,而是直接舍弃,故将其称为“EX成绩写入保护”。 【并不是一度认为的EX recent成绩一定会被保留的观点】

此机制的存在可以充分解释为何h1r、higllus等人为何在最后集体刷全难度理论值时并不会因为recent记录一些交替而导致掉分,因为在EX后的记录如果成绩太低并不会写入recent。 至于掉分的情况的论证则很简单,五月初爬梯子只打Blaster连续15次不足EX就突然被扣了0.02,五月二十日conflict推分掉ptt截图在推特可见 对于爬分玩家而言,此机制的存在相对避免了了断网保分的极端措施,EX之上即可获得保险

  • PM保护机制证伪说明(2018.06.29):由RichadoWonosas的掉分个人证明,其ptt在recent为0的情况下为8.80,等效为11.73平均分。
掉分前已PM过Cybernecia Catharsis,当时定数为9.8,PM得分11.8>11.73。
很明显若PM具有强制保留机制的话那么其放置30次的结果应大于recent为0即8.80的情况,故PM强制留存记录的机制不存在。
  • Blurring Shadow发现了Xecus的机器人可以查询单次游玩的ptt后,联系了页面编辑者Vanitas和RichadoWonosas进行相关实验,修正了单曲ptt计算系数
一些定数勘误有【FTR】Fracture Ray 11.2→11.1 The Message 9.8→9.7 Sulfur 9.9→9.8 【PRS】Grievous Lady 9.2→9.1等(均为v3.0.0之前的定数)
  • 关于v3.0.0之前9,800,000 - 9,949,999分数段内的变化率比例(即,这一段分数内PTT增长率与9,800,000分以下的PTT增长率的比值)为0.75的证明可参照RichadoWonosas的专栏PTT研究附录:一个被误算了许久的比例

备注

  1. 仅限单次游玩ptt>0的情况,具体见单次成绩ptt计算
  2. 由于ptt计算过程中包含向下取整,会有取整后ptt为0.00的情况